Analysis

In 2024, gross intake ratio to the last grade of lower secondary general in W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d) stood at 64.5%. That is the highest value across all 51 years on record.

The figure is up 3.9% on the previous year and up 19.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, gross intake ratio to the last grade of lower secondary general in W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d) peaked at 64.5%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 29.4%, in 1974.

WB: Middle East & North Africa (ida & Ibrd) ranks 146th of 219 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 51 years of available data.
